Computers & Accessories in Chesham, Buckinghamshire,
Computers & Accessories
1 Broadway Court The Broadway, High Street,
Chesham, Buckinghamshire ,
HP5 1EG
UNITED KINGDOM
Worldwide > United Kingdom > Chesham, Buckinghamshire > Computers & Accessories